David Powell is an Americana artist with a broad musical lens, blending folk traditions with rock grit, country twang, and the raw energy of folk-punk. Rooted in storytelling and shaped by years of playing, writing, and wandering, his music carries the soul of backroads, barrooms, and busking corners.

David picked up the guitar in fifth grade thanks to his dad, and he hasn’t put it down since. Raised near Washington, D.C., he cut his teeth playing bass in a prog-rock band that mostly haunted church basements and all-ages shows—“we weren’t very good, but we were loud,” he says. Frequently grounded during middle school, guitar became both outlet and obsession, laying the foundation for the songwriter he is today.

In college, David turned to busking instead of clocking into a day job—staking out a corner in the bar district from 10 PM to 2 AM, serenading passersby and collecting tips from tipsy generosity. That experience sharpened his ability to connect with audiences on the fly—something that continues to shine through in both his solo sets and band performances.

His first band, Outside Eliza, released two studio records: an alt-rock debut followed by a country-leaning second release, Shame. The standout track, “Hairdo,” was featured on Pittsburgh’s WDVE as a highlighted local artist. David's current project, The Laurel Lowlifes, has played key regional festivals including Three Rivers Arts Festival and Boom on the Bridge, and is slated as second billing for WYEP’s Neighborhood Concert Series at Settler’s Cabin Park this September. With The Laurel Lowlifes, David released a home-recorded folk EP and is preparing to drop three new studio singles—taking lead vocals on one.

A student of American roots music, David finds inspiration in artists like Old Crow Medicine Show and Trampled by Turtles, but also pulls influence from jazz standards, folk-punk, and everything in between. A major creative turning point came from working through Rolling Stone’s 500 Greatest Songs of All Time—learning classics by ear, and letting them reshape his approach to both covers and songwriting.

Today, David is focused on continuing to create original music with close collaborators while expanding his work as a solo cover artist. His dream project? A big-band standards album in the spirit of early Emmylou Harris—where genre bends, but feeling stays true.
